Applications of Titanium Dioxide in the UK throughout
Titanium dioxide is a versatile material with diverse applications extending across numerous industries within the UK. One key application lies through its use as a white pigment used in paints, coatings, and plastics. This property allows manufacturers to achieve vivid colors and enhance longevity. Furthermore, titanium dioxide plays a crucial role in the production of suncreens, providing critical UV protection.
Its excellent photocatalytic properties also make it suitable as applications like air and water purification, contributing to a cleaner environment.
In the culinary industry, titanium dioxide is frequently used as a food additive to impart whiteness and opacity on certain products like confectionery and dairy.
Nonetheless, it's important to note that the use of titanium dioxide in food is currently under scrutiny by regulatory bodies due to potential health concerns.

Impact of Titanium Dioxide on UK Environment and Health
Titanium dioxide is a widely utilized ingredient in numerous products, ranging from suncreams to paints and plastics. However, its common use has raised questions regarding its potential impact on both the UK natural world and human safety.
Some studies suggest that titanium dioxide nanoparticles may accumulate in the earth, potentially affecting plant growth and natural processes. Moreover, there are suggestions that inhalation of titanium dioxide dust may present risks to human respiratory system. Further investigation is essential to fully understand the long-term consequences of titanium dioxide on the UK citizens.
